Looking through the large patch Uli checked in, I've noticed a few
minor nits in the glibc 2.2 branch:
- __libc_freeres should have version 2.1.3.
- the default definition for __attribute_malloc__ in <malloc.h>
overwrites the one from <sys/cdefs.h> for external programs. It
should be removed.
- open is declared in <fcntl.h>, __libc_open* should therefore be
declared in include/fcntl.h.
- libc-start.c declares __libc_open and __libc_fcntl - I moved those
to include/fcntl.h as well.
The patch for include/fcntl.h should also go into glibc 2.1.3 (with
the addition of __libc_lseek to unistd.h).

1999-12-19 Andreas Jaeger <aj@suse.de>
* sysdeps/generic/libc-start.c: Remove declaration of
__libc_open. Move declaration of __libc_fcntl to ...
* include/fcntl.h: ...here.
* include/unistd.h: Move __libc_open and __libc_open64 to ...
* include/fcntl.h: ...here.
* malloc/malloc.h (__attribute_malloc__): Remove default
definition for __attribute_malloc__.
* malloc/Versions: __libc_freeres was exported with glibc 2.1.3,
rename label.
